A quick and easy one-pan lasagna that uses thinly sliced butternut squash instead of pasta. It’s a healthy, comforting, and delicious weeknight dinner that comes together in under an hour.
For best results, slice squash about 1/8-inch thick. Let lasagna rest for 10-15 minutes before serving to allow layers to set. To prevent a watery lasagna, do not over-sauce and pat spinach dry if damp. For a dairy-free version, use cashew ricotta and vegan mozzarella and Parmesan.
